What Is Beat the Streets Wrestling?
Beat the Streets Wrestling is a series of wrestling events organized by Beat the Streets, a non-profit organization dedicated to supporting youth wrestling programs and promoting the sport. These events are often held in unique locations, from Times Square in New York City to various other iconic venues, bringing wrestling to a wider audience and creating a memorable experience for both athletes and fans. The primary goal is to raise funds and awareness for youth wrestling programs, supporting the development of young wrestlers across the country.
These events typically feature matches between top-ranked wrestlers from around the world. The competition is fierce, with athletes often competing at the highest levels of the sport, including Olympic and World Championship medalists. The atmosphere is electric, with passionate fans cheering on their favorite wrestlers and creating a truly exciting environment. The matches are usually contested under the rules of the United World Wrestling (UWW), the international governing body for the sport.

Where to Watch Beat the Streets Wrestling
Finding the right platform to watch Beat the Streets Wrestling is crucial. Here’s a breakdown of the most common ways to catch the action:
1. Flowrestling
FloWrestling is often the primary source for streaming Beat the Streets Wrestling events. They offer a comprehensive platform with live streams, replays, and on-demand content. You’ll need a subscription to access their content, but it’s a worthwhile investment for serious wrestling fans. FloWrestling typically provides:
- Live Streams: Watch matches as they happen, in real-time.
- Replays: Access archived matches to watch at your convenience.
- Exclusive Content: Behind-the-scenes interviews, training videos, and other wrestling-related content.
- High-Quality Streaming: Enjoy a smooth and clear viewing experience.
Subscription Options: FloWrestling offers various subscription plans, including monthly and annual options. The annual subscription often provides the best value. Consider your viewing habits and budget when choosing a plan. Remember to check for any available promotions or discounts.
How to Subscribe: Visit the FloWrestling website and create an account. Choose your preferred subscription plan and complete the payment process. Once subscribed, you can log in and start watching live events and on-demand content.

3. Match Formats
Beat the Streets Wrestling events may use different match formats. The most common formats are Freestyle wrestling and Greco-Roman wrestling. Freestyle allows the use of legs in offensive and defensive maneuvers, while Greco-Roman prohibits any holds below the waist.
Format Details:
- Freestyle Wrestling: Allows the use of legs for takedowns and defense.
- Greco-Roman Wrestling: No holds below the waist; focused on upper-body strength and technique.
